Most of the time, we have seen people getting fired day in and day out, for the faults they commit, while carrying out their duties. Its very normal for humans to make mistakes. Some make very little mistakes, some have a habit of being the frontrunners in making errors. Apart from failing to perform up to the standards or expectations, people sometimes do tend to take the firing by the senior management in a different manner and start losing their self confidance and so fall in a kind of trap of self destruction. People should understand that there are always limitations of infrastructure, which holds up the processes and financially its not possible for every business organisation to build up so much backups to avoid any mishaps. Above all, customers at the receiving end have a right to shout at the every moment of breakdown, as his desires of getting the idle, ultimate production at much more than the rated speed, shatters at every breakdown. Every customer wants to wipe off the word "Downtime" from the dictonary of this high speed working environment.
People at the receiving end should take heart and should have to build heart to accept the blame of not performing up to the expectations of the esteemed paying customers. This does not mean that they should not worry about the mistakes and stop performing. It simply means that try to give the best possible out of you and then leave the rest for the almighty God to take care. One should learn to add value to the job he or she is performing, every moment for the best results, rest is not under his or her control.
